Snow Mountain Trail HikePosted by Ed in Training, Uncategorized, tags: Fall, Hike, Snow Mountain RanchLast week, we hiked part of the Snow Mountain trail at Snow Mountain Ranch, in Tabernash, CO. The GPX file of the hike is here (It can be opened in Google Earth). It was a reasonably hard climb with some steep sections. I averaged around 120 BMP heart rate climbing with a peak of just over 150. Below is a screenshot of the trail and heart rate/elevation graph and a slideshow of all the images (not just the trail, but the whole day we spent at Snow Mountain Ranch). The fall colors were just hitting peak and the weather was warm and sunny.

Labor Day Weekend ActivitiesPosted by Ed in GPS-Maps, Training, tags: Hayman Fire, HikeOur long weekend started Friday and lasted through Monday. It was marked by a definite change in weather that gave us cooler temps, our first hint of fall. We did a hike on Goose Creek Trail in the Lost Creek Wilderness. Below area a few screen shot images of the day assembled using Google Earth. The full Google Earth KMZ file is here. These screenshots include an image overlay of the Hayman Fire burn area. It might not be exact because I had to manually insert the image and size it as best as possible. This was a significant fire during the summer of 2002. Our drive route in lime green through the burn area was over dirt roads to the trailhead.
The initial 1/4 mile or so of the hike was through burn area to the canyon floor. After that, we enjoyed fairly lush vegetation throughout the hike. For full trail descriptions, I posted content and uploaded our hike to Wikiloc and Everytrail.
